Understanding your first Business Broadband bill

Your very first broadband bill will be issued, and payment taken, on the date you connect to 2degrees Business Broadband. Because we bill in advance, this is to cover your first month of plan charges.

We’ll generate your first bill at sign-up and will email this to you (you can also find it within Your 2degrees dashboard).

Your first bill is due immediately. Your first bill will include a deposit of the first month's plan fee, connection fee (if applicable), and any one-off charges such as if you’ve rented a modem from us (modem rental and delivery fees will be applied), or any 2degrees phones you’ve purchased.

Your second bill will include your normal plan fee, and any pro-rated charges from your connection date to the end of the previous month. It will also show a reversal of the deposit of one month's plan fee.

What’s my invoice date and billing cycle for Business Broadband? 

Your billing cycle will be the calendar month – from the 1st to the end of each month. Each bill is generated on the 2nd of the month and is due on the 20th.

You can either make a manual payment once you have received the invoice (due by the 20th of each month) or set up an automatic payment using a credit card or direct debit account.

Automatic payments will be processed on the 20th, or the following business day if this falls on a bank holiday (for Direct Debit).

A 1.75% card payment fee applies to all Broadband payments made by Credit Card.

How are my Business Broadband Add-ons and monthly plan charged?

Plan fees and Add-on charges will be invoiced in advance. Other usage based charges will be invoiced in arrears.

Other items charged in arrears include:

  • Any fees related to changes to your connection and/or service
  • Charges for Add-ons added in the middle of your plan cycle
  • Any hardware charges (modem or phone), including shipping.

What are my payment options for Business Broadband?

There are a number of ways you can pay your bill. You can set up an automatic payment with either a credit card, debit card or Direct Debit Authority when you sign up. This payment method will be charged each month, on your billing due date.

You can also log into Your 2degrees and choose to make a manual payment with a valid credit or debit card. Cards that can be used include Visa, Mastercard and American Express. There is a 1.75% card payment fee that applies to credit card and debit card transactions.

You can also make a manual payment via Internet banking; your bill will explain what is required to do this.

Business Broadband price increase – October 2020

In September 2020 we notified business customers who signed up to broadband before 1 June 2020 that the price of their broadband plan was increasing by $4 a month from October.

Over the past four years, the costs from our suppliers for us to provide broadband have gone up. This unfortunately means we need to increase our prices so that we can continue to deliver the services that keep your business connected.

If we’ve set up the automatic payment for you via either Direct Debit or Credit Card payment, then there’s nothing you need to do. We’ll make the change on our end and automatically deduct the correct amount, including the extra $4.

If you’ve set up an automatic payment yourself with your bank, you’ll need to make sure you update the payment amount to include an extra $4. We can't do this on your behalf if you’ve set it up separately.
